Wildflower seed bombs are little ecosystems containing pollinator friendly wildflower seeds. Seed Bombs protect native wildflower seeds from being eaten by wildlife, providing ideal conditions for wildflower seeds to grow and support pollinators. These unique flower bombs are crafted from a mixture of sifted soil, compost and a mix of 34 native UK wildflower seed species.
They are suitable for sunny and shady garden areas and contain 100% pure wildflower seeds. Simply place Wildflower Seed Bombs onto bare soil in containers on patios and balconies or in open flower borders, and allow the rain to activate them. The soil must be watered in dry weather to keep it moist for germination and growth results.

When to Plant Wildflower Seed Bombs
Seed bombs can be planted any time of the year as the wildflower seeds are protected in their soil bombs and will activate when the right growing conditions are present. Here are some tips when you want to grow Wildflowers at specific times of the year:
Planting Seed Bombs during Autumn months following nature’s natural growth cycle. Wild flower seeds like a good freeze to break dormancy and will grow when the right conditions are present in early Springtime. Seed Bombs can be planted through Winter months when the soil is soft enough to press them onto the earth.
Flowering June - August.
Early Springtime is a good time to set Seed Bombs, there is usually good rainfall to keep the soil moist for germination. When planting seed bombs in late Spring, it’s a good idea to soak them in water prior to planting onto wet soil.
Flowering July-Sept

In Autumn the wildflower seed heads form, thanks to the pollination work many wildflower seeds fall onto the earth, to grow and flower the following season. The wildflower seeds are also food for ants and other insects, birds and tiny field mice.
Many wildlife creatures love to make homes in Wildflowers such as frogs and hedgehogs, they feast upon slugs and other insects, creating an area of Biodiversity.
